LONDONDERRY,CapitalVault N.H. (AP) — A small plane crashed in a neighborhood near the Manchester-Boston Regional Airport in New Hampshire shortly after takeoff and firefighters helped remove the pilot, who was taken to a hospital, authorities said Friday.

The pilot was the only person on board Wiggins Air Flight 1046, the Federal Aviation Administration said in a statement. The Beechcraft 99 crashed about 7:30 a.m. local time.

The cargo plane was headed to Presque Isle International Airport in Maine, the FAA said.

The Londonderry Fire Department extricated the pilot. He was brought to a hospital. His condition was not immediately announced.

The FAA and the National Transportation Safety Board will investigate.
